President Muhammadu Buhari has given a marching order to all heads of security and intelligent agencies to rescue all hostages in the captivity of bandits across the country, particularly victims of the recent train terrorist attack.
This was the major focus of discourse at the national security meeting, the first to be held in 2022.
Briefing state house correspondents after the three and a half hours meeting, the national security adviser, Babagana Monguno said Mr President expressed sadness over the recent security challenges and directed all the intelligence elements to rescue aducted Nigerians from the dens of bandits and kidnappers unhurt.
The other agenda of the strategic security meeting centered on the memo presented by the office of the NSA with focus on the need to increase security operations along the vast national land borders.
The memo suggested the need to figure how the land borders could be safer considering the enormous influx of foreigners who enter the country illegally , even as the security situation in northeast has improved considerably.
